Khyber Pakhtunkhwa’s Special Assistant for Information, Shafi Jan, has rejected the federal government’s statement regarding the displacement of the local population from Tirah Valley, calling it baseless, fabricated, and an attempt to mislead the public.
Shafi Jan said the federal government is unsuccessfully trying to shift the entire blame for the operation in Tirah Valley and the resulting displacement of people onto the provincial government, whereas the reality is that the local population was forced to migrate because of the operation.
He stated that speeches made in the National Assembly by Federal Ministers Khawaja Asif and Talal Chaudhry are on record, in which they clearly acknowledged the operation. Despite this, facts are now being denied.
The Special Assistant for Information further said that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Chief Minister Suhail Afridi has clarified his stance on the operation in Tirah Valley multiple times. He added that during the provincial assembly’s peace jirga, all political parties unanimously opposed the operation.
Shafi Jan said the federal government should have taken the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a government, political parties, and other relevant stakeholders into confidence before taking any action, but instead, decisions were made behind closed doors.

He termed the federal government’s statement regarding the release of four billion rupees in funds by the provincial government for the affected people as “ridiculous,” saying the provincial government took timely steps to provide immediate relief to those who evacuated, while the federal government is showing indifference.
Shafi Jan questioned whether people who were forced to displace should be left helpless and without support?
He said the federal government is imposing decisions on the province on one hand, and on the other, leaving the affected people alone in difficult times, which is regrettable.
Meanwhile, the federal government says that no orders have been issued by the government or the army to evacuate Tirah Valley in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a.
In a statement issued Sunday from the X (formerly Twitter) account of the Federal Ministry of Information, it was said that the government has taken notice of misleading reports claiming that Tirah Valley was being evacuated on the orders of the army.
